God of War Ragnarök: Mystical Heirloom—What Does It Do?

🎙️ Voice is AI-generated. Inconsistencies may occur.

Players will encounter the Mystical Heirloom while exploring near Tyr's Temple in God of War Ragnarök. When you first discover this collectible, the game notes that it doesn't appear to have much use, but this couldn't be further from the truth. The Mystical Heirloom is actually used to trigger four miniboss fights, which when completed will allow you to obtain the Steinbjorn Armor.

How to Find the Mystical Heirloom

If you haven't discovered the Mystical Heirloom relic in God of War Ragnarök just yet, proceed through the game until you reach Tyr's Temple in Midgard. Next, head south of the Lake of Nine and beyond the temple itself. You'll need to have obtained the Draupnir Spear in order to continue, so make sure you've progressed at least to that point in the game.

Using the Draupnir Spear, throw it at the wall of ice. This will break open a new pathway, allowing you to walk through it. From here, look for a poisonous Scorn Pole to the right and then look left to spot a corpse, with the Mystical Heirloom nearby.

How to Use the Mystical Heirloom

Now that you have the Mystical Heirloom, it is time to talk about using it. Much like the other relics you encounter in God of War Ragnarök, you'll need to equip the Mystical Heirloom to get any use out of it. However, this isn't a combat relic, so you won't get much help perfecting your parry or even mastering the art of staggering enemies. Instead, you'll use the Mystical Heirloom to interact with four specific statues found through the Nine Realms.

One of the statues itself can be found in Midgard, while another is found in Alfheim. The final two, though, are found while exploring Vanaheim. These statues are exactly what you'd expect them to be, so you shouldn't have much trouble finding them while out exploring. When you do find one, approach it with the Mystical Heirloom attached, and then press L1 + Circle to bring the troll out of its stony slumber.

This will trigger a boss fight, which you'll need to complete if you want to unlock the armor attached to this relic. Once defeated, the trolls will drop a Slumber Stone, which you will need if you wish to craft the Steinbjorn Armor.

Because these boss fights are more difficult, it's highly recommended that players have an idea of how to fast travel around the world and that they have spent some time increasing their health so they can survive more hits.
